Further details about the role
Key Duties
- To set high expectations for all pupils, to deepen their knowledge and understanding and to maximise their achievement.
- To use a variety of methods and approaches (including differentiation) to match curricular objectives and the range of pupil needs, and ensure equal opportunity for all pupils
- To ensure continuity, progression and cohesiveness in all teaching.
- To assess pupils’ work systematically and use the results to inform future planning, teaching and curricular development.
- To have a thorough and up-to-date knowledge and understanding of the National Curriculum programmes of study, level descriptors and specifications for examination courses.
